Architecting with Google Cloud: Design and Process
This course features a combination of lectures, design activities, and hands-on labs to show you how to use proven design patterns on Google Cloud to build highly reliable and efficient solutions and operate deployments that are highly available and cost-effective. This course was created for those who have already completed the Architecting with Google Compute Engine or Architecting with Google Kubernetes Engine course.

What you'll learn
- Apply a tool set of questions, techniques and design considerations.
- Define application requirements and express them objectively as KPIs, SLO's and SLI's.
- Decompose application requirements to find the right microservice boundaries.
- Leverage Google Cloud developer tools to set up modern, automated deployment pipelines.
- Choose the appropriate Google Cloud Storage services based on application requirements.
- Discuss Google Cloud network architectures, including hybrid architectures.
- Implement reliable, scalable, resilient applications balancing key performance metrics with cost.
- Choose the right Google Cloud deployment services for your applications.
- Secure cloud applications, data and infrastructure.
- Monitor service level objectives and costs using Cloud Monitoring.
Prerequisites
- Have completed Architecting with Google Compute Engine, Architecting with Google Kubernetes Engine, or have equivalent experience.
- Have basic proficiency with command-line tools and Linux operating system environments.
- Have systems operations experience, including deploying and managing applications, either on-premises or in a public cloud environment.
